Cambodian Banana and Tapioca Dessert
Prep time
9 min
Cook time
21 min
Yield
2 servings
Difficulty
MEDIUM

Ingredients

Quantities are shown as originally provided.

  • 2-3 ripe bananas (peeled and sliced)
  • 4 cups water
  • 1/3 cup small tapioca pearls
  • 1/2 can (13.5 oz coconut milk)
  • 1/3 cup sugar (adjust to taste)
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 pandan leaf (optional, for flavor)
  • Crushed ice (optional, for serving)

Instructions

  1. 1

    Rinse the tapioca pearls in cold water and drain.

  2. 2

    In a saucepan, combine the tapioca pearls with enough water to cover them. Bring it to a boil, then reduce the heat and simmer for about 7-10 minutes or until the tapioca pearls become translucent.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king.

  3. 3

    combine the coconut milk, sugar, and salt. If you have a pandan leaf, you can tie it into a knot and add it for extra flavor. Heat the mixture over medium-low heat, stirring until the sugar is fully dissolved. Do not let it boil.

  4. 4

    Remove the pandan leaf (if used) and discard it.

  5. 5

    Add the sliced bananas to the mixture and stir gently to combine. Let it simmer for another 2-3 minutes, just until the bananas are heated through.

  6. 6

    Remove from heat and let it cool slightly.

  7. 7

    If desired, serve the Cambodian Banana and Tapioca Dessert warm or chilled over crushed ice.
